The Jenz 581 is a used wood chipper — sometimes called a wood shredder or chipping machine — designed to process timber, branches, and woody biomass into uniform wood chips. Machines of this type are widely used in forestry operations, biomass energy production, landscaping, and waste wood recycling, where reducing bulky material to a consistent chip size is essential for handling, transport, or fuel preparation.
Jenz is a German manufacturer with a strong reputation in the forestry and biomass sector, known for producing robust chipping and shredding equipment that serves both industrial and commercial operators across Europe and beyond.
